What Are Chemical Peels?

A chemical peel is a treatment that uses carefully formulated acids to exfoliate the outer layers of the skin. As the treated skin sheds, new, healthier skin emerges with a more even tone and smoother texture.

Types of Chemical Peels

Superficial Peels

  • Use mild acids like glycolic or lactic acid
  • Target the outermost skin layer
  • Minimal downtime

Medium Peels

  • Use stronger acids like TCA (trichloroacetic acid)
  • Penetrate deeper layers
  • More effective for moderate pigmentation

Deep Peels

  • Use potent solutions for significant skin concerns
  • Require more downtime and recovery

What Are Laser Treatments?

laser vs chemical peels for dark spots

Laser treatments use focused light energy to target melanin (pigment) in the skin. The pigment absorbs the energy, breaks down, and is naturally cleared by the body over time.

Unlike chemical peels, lasers can target specific areas without affecting surrounding skin, making them more precise.

Laser vs Chemical Peels for dark spots: Key Differences

1. Depth of Treatment

  • Chemical Peels: Work on the surface layers of the skin
  • Lasers: Penetrate deeper to target pigment at its source

2. Precision

  • Peels: Treat the entire surface area
  • Lasers: Can target specific spots without affecting surrounding skin

3. Results Timeline

  • Peels: Gradual improvement over multiple sessions
  • Lasers: Faster, more visible results in fewer sessions

4. Downtime

  • Light Peels: Minimal to no downtime
  • Medium/Deep Peels: Several days to weeks
  • Lasers: Varies from minimal to moderate depending on intensity

5. Cost

  • Peels: More budget-friendly
  • Lasers: Higher investment but often fewer sessions needed

Which Treatment Works Better for Dark Spots?

The answer depends on the type and depth of your pigmentation.

Choose Chemical Peels If You Have:

  • Mild sun damage
  • Superficial dark spots
  • Uneven skin tone
  • Dull or rough skin texture

Chemical peels are excellent for maintenance and overall skin refresh.

Choose Laser Treatments If You Have:

  • Deep or stubborn pigmentation
  • Melasma or age spots
  • Acne-related dark marks
  • Mixed concerns (texture + pigmentation)

Laser treatments are generally more effective for targeted, long-lasting results, especially when pigmentation is deeper in the skin.

Important Considerations Before Treatment

Skin Tone

Darker skin tones require careful treatment selection to avoid post-inflammatory hyperpigmentation. Technologies like Nd:YAG lasers or gentle peels are often preferred.

Downtime

If you have a busy schedule, lighter treatments with minimal recovery may be more suitable.

Consistency

Both treatments require consistency and proper aftercare, especially sun protection, to maintain results.
